Dahlberg appointed head of Scania Buses and Coaches

Klas Dahlberg, 47, currently Scania’s vice president, non-captive market areas, has been appointed senior vice president buses & coaches. During the period 2007 to 2011 Dahlberg was vice president of Scania franchise and factory sales, and responsible for sales and marketing of trucks, buses and coaches to distributors of Scania products in the region.

German government rejects motorway tolls for tour coaches

GERMANY The German Bundesrat, the upper house of parliament has voted in favour of draft Federal Government legislation which will stop the introduction of motorway tolls for tour coaches. First new generation Citaro delivered to Lücke-Reisen

GERMANY The first of the new generation Mercedes-Benz Citaros has been delivered to Lücke-Reisen. It was handed on 19 September by Konstantinos Tsiknas, head of sales for Mercedes-Benz Buses and Coaches in Germany, to managing directors Anne and Uwe Lücke. Lücke-Reisen is based in Nordkirchen, Germany.

Germans open up transport competition

GERMANY The German government has given its approval to a planned lifting of restrictions on charter-bus companies. The move will open the way for express coach business to actively compete with state railway Deutsche Bahn and offer increased travel options to passengers for long-haul routes.
